What is a guard condition? Explain it with a suitable example.
The guard-condition is a Boolean expression written with respect to parameters of triggering event and attributes and links of object which owns state machine. The guard condition can also involve tests of simultaneous states of the current machine (or explicitly designated states of some available object); for case, "in State1" or "not in State2". State names can be fully qualified by nested states which contain them, yielding path names of form ''State1: State2::State3''; this can be used in a case where same state name occurs in various composite state regions of an overall machine.
